This release of the Fernhollow greenhouse controller addresses cumulative humidity-sensor drift observed in the Larkspur test beds. The recalibration routine runs at boot and writes correction offsets to a tamper-evident log; reviewers should confirm the log partition is mounted read-only post-write. No network-facing surfaces changed in this cycle, but the OTA channel now enforces stricter manifest validation. All artifacts in this release were signed with the key reproduced below for your verification.

rollout seal: bky4_x7Gc

Ticket: Config drift in the LiftSim sandbox again. Plugin authors have been seeing dispatch latencies that don't match docs because someone hand-edited the staging node last week. If your hall-call plugin behaves oddly, that's why — not your code. We've reset the sandbox to the blessed baseline, so please rebuild against it. For reference, the canonical configuration your plugins should assume is the following.

deployment values, yadug-bawif:
[framir]
team = pelox
access_code = ac_a38ab2
owner = tamion.julael
host = framir.tolvaqlabs.test
port = 11211
peer = tammir.zemvargrid.local
salt = 2215ef03
pin = 1541

Customer Concentration Risk — Managers Only. Branch managers should be aware that Fenholt Retail Group now accounts for approximately 38% of group revenue, up from 26% two years ago. Any disruption to the Fenholt relationship — contract renegotiation, ownership change, or payment delay — would materially affect all branches. Mitigation steps include broadening the mid-market pipeline and capping new Fenholt-linked credit exposure. Do not discuss this dependency with clients or suppliers. Further detail follows below.

confidential, yahip-hagug: Gorixax Logistics plans to lower the Ulaael list price by 26.6 percent in October. The pricing group signed off on a budget of $199.9 million for Project Holix. The renewal with Kasdorox Systems closes at $137.5 million a year, 8.2 percent above the last contract. Project Lamion slips by a full year because of the audit delay.